Fish Curry

Cooking time: 30 mins

Serving: 4

Ingredients

500gFish Fillets
2 tbspGhee
1Onion, finely chopped
2Garlic Cloves, finely chopped
1 tbspFresh Coriander, chopped
1 tbspFresh Mint, chopped
1 tspGround Cumin
1 tspTumeric
1 tspChilli Powder
1Ripe Tomato, chopped
1 tspSalt
1 1/2 tspGaram Masala
Lemon Juice to taste

Method

  • Clean the fish and cut into large pieces.
  • Heat the ghee in a saucepan and on low heat fry the onion, garlic, coriander and mint until onion is soft and golden.
  • Add the cumin, turmeric and chili powder and stir until the spices are cooked.
  • Add the tomato, salt and garam masala, stirring, until tomato is cooked to a pulp.
  • Add lemon juice and check whether more salt is needed.
  • Place the pieces of fish into the sauce, spooning it over the fish. Cover and simmer for 10 minutes, or until fish is cooked.
